Finance Manager
Head Office

The overall goal of the job: 

The Finance Manager is primarily responsible for managing a company's financial affairs, including financial planning, risk management, financial reporting, and ensuring compliance with accounting policies and procedures and local laws. The Finance Manager works to enhance the company's financial sustainability and achieve its short- and long-term economic goals.

Essential duties:

- Develop strategic financial plans to achieve corporate objectives .
- Oversee the preparation and analysis of financial reports .
- Manage budgets and ensure a balance between revenue and expenditures .
- Provide financial advice to senior management on investments and risks .
- Establish and implement financial policies in compliance with regulations .
- Monitor cash flows and ensure liquidity for operational needs .
- Coordinate with financial institutions such as banks and investor

Product Marketing Manager
Head Office

As the Product Manager, you will play a key role in supporting the product development lifecycle, from conceptualization to launch. Working closely with cross-functional teams, you will be responsible for conducting market research, analyzing competitor strategies, and contributing to the development of new product concepts to meet our customer’s needs.

 

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ES:

- Conduct comprehensive benchmarking analyses to identify market trends, competitor strategies, and opportunities for product enhancement.

- Assist in the development of innovative product concepts, features, and positioning strategies in collaboration with R&D, Marketing, and Sales teams.

- Plan and execute product launches, including market research, pricing strategies, and promotional activities.

- Monitor post launch performance metrics and analyze customer feedback to drive continuous improvement and product optimization.

- Stay informed about industry developments, emerging technologies, and customer preferences to inform product development strategies.
